Amazing Sun-Dried Tomato Cream Sauce

Reviewed: Sep. 18, 2008
This is a great recipe. It took me less than half an hour to make this sauce, just heat up a few ingredients and voila! Making your own home made sauce really couldn't be any easier, and it's so good! The only changes I made, I soaked the sun-dried tomatoes in hot water for a few minutes to soften them up because I like them a little mushy. Also, when I tossed the tomatoes into the sauce I threw in a handful of fresh basil as well. It came out great, I just finished eating some right now and I couldn't wait to rate this recipe. Definitely will become a 'regular'.
